2008 Lotus Elise vs. 1990 Saab 9000

To start off, 2008 Lotus Elise is newer by 18 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Saab 9000.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Saab 9000 would be higher. At 2,290 cc (4 cylinders), 1990 Saab 9000 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1990 Saab 9000 (197 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 77 more horse power than 2008 Lotus Elise. (120 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1990 Saab 9000 should accelerate faster than 2008 Lotus Elise.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1990 Saab 9000 weights approximately 609 kg more than 2008 Lotus Elise.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2008 Lotus Elise is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2008 Lotus Elise.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1990 Saab 9000,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1990 Saab 9000 (330 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 162 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Lotus Elise. (168 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 1990 Saab 9000 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Lotus Elise.
